forked from pool/python-celery
- Now depends on kombu 2.4.0
- Now depends on billiard 2.7.3.12
- Redis: Celery now tries to restore messages whenever there are no messages
in the queue.
- Crontab schedules now properly respects CELERY_TIMEZONE setting.
It's important to note that crontab schedules uses UTC time by default
unless this setting is set.
Issue #904 and django-celery #150.
- billiard.enable_forking is now only set by the processes pool.
- The transport is now properly shown by celery report
(Issue #913).
- The --app argument now works if the last part is a module name
(Issue #921).
- Fixed problem with unpickleable exceptions (billiard #12).
- Adds task_name attribute to EagerResult which is always
None (Issue #907).
- Old Task class in celery.task no longer accepts magic kwargs by
default (Issue #918).
A regression long ago disabled magic kwargs for these, and since
no one has complained about it we don't have any incentive to fix it now.
- The inspect reserved control command did not work properly.
- Should now play better with static analyzation tools by explicitly
specifying dynamically created attributes in the celery and
celery.task modules.
- Terminating a task now results in
celery.exceptions.RevokedTaskError instead of a WorkerLostError.
- AsyncResult.revoke now accepts terminate and signal arguments.
- The task-revoked event now includes new fields: terminated,
signum, and expired.
OBS-URL: https://build.opensuse.org/package/show/devel:languages:python/python-celery?expand=0&rev=65
2.8 KiB
2.8 KiB